Super excellent venue- fully renovated 1850 St Paul's Church. Venue and location is definitely the biggest attraction, and the beer is also quite good. We visited on a Thursday evening, enjoyed 3 beers, apps, and dinner. The beer was all 4/5, the loaded tots and pretzel apps were good, and the food was also good. We had the Double Smash burger, steak sandwich, and Tritip salad. Each were 4/5. The service was good. We would definitely return again and again, and it would be a favorite if we lived in the area.

We had a nice casual meal ahead of attending the opera at the nearby Cincinnati Music Hall. The food was great - the burgers, salads and most of all the Bavarian pretzel with the beer cheese. Atmosphere was great - the location is a deconsecrated church, TVs for viewing events and even the upper choir area is open for seating. Good views into the brewing operation, and easy to find. Local parking can be a challenge. You will need to probably park at a garage nearby and walk a short distance. Service was great - our server Johnna knew the menu and helped us make some good picks as to what to drink.
